BOB Gear Alterrain Up 50+ Stroller

A sleek, robust jogger with a performance fabric that stands up to rough terrain and the elements. It has SmoothShoxa, Csuspension and air-filled tires that absorb bumps and balance out the ride for your kid. A locking front wheel that swivels and handbrake allow for maneuverability in the most tense corners and the steepest hills. It's also travel system ready and can be used with the majority of major brand car seats with the use of the BOB infant car seat adapter (sold separately). It features a single-hand fold that folds into self-standing, and its slim profile makes it easy to store in tight spaces.

It was awarded a top score in the metric for child comfort and comes with a cushioned sling seat and adjustable recline. It has a huge canopy that covers most riders until the knee and is UPF50+. It has a large magnetic peek-aboo window and adjustable ventilation to keep you child at ease.

This stroller comes with only one disadvantage: it's a little long and takes up more space in your car than other strollers. This is a typical feature of all terrain joggers.

BOB is among the leading brands in the market and this jogger is the brand's flagship. Stellar Baby Gear Reviews gave the stroller a high score due to its elegant design, comfort and durability. It is also equipped with a secure and safe harness that will ensure your child's safety.

This is an excellent option for parents looking for a light, all terrain jogger. It comes with a weight limit of 75 pounds and will grow with your child. Plus, it's incredibly simple to use. It's simple to use, with an easy-to-fold mechanism that is a game changer. You can even put all your items in the storage basket included. It's not necessary to be the Hulk in order to lift this stroller. It weighs just 32.5 pounds. This is a great option for hikers, runners, or anyone looking for a sturdy All-terrain pram stroller. It's a bit more expensive than some of the other lightweight strollers on this list, but it is worth the investment for the durability and quality.

Pockit+ All-terrain pram Stroller

The GB Pockit is a stroller with a unique ultra-compact fold which reduces it to the size of an ordinary handbag (making it hand luggage for airplanes fully compliant). It is small in footprint and is extremely easy to maneuver and carry. It is also among the best lightweight strollers to use in urban areas.

This small pushchair has a surprising amount of features that include a huge UPF50+ canopy as well as recline that can be adjusted to nearly completely flat. It's compatible with numerous car seats including the award-winning Cybex Infant Car Seat. It also has nimble front wheels that help you navigate around tight spaces.

The seat is cushioned with a mesh that breathes and keeps your child cool on hot days. It also comes with a an inlay with a soft padded padding that can be added to the seat for cooler temperatures. The harness webbing and padding are skin-friendly, and the buckle is simple, with two prongs that require about 10-15lbs of pressure to release.

Despite the fact that it has a few hinge points, the Pockit feels less elegant and refined than its rivals, and has an unwieldy feel. Its flex is most noticeable on hard surfaces, and it is often felt like the wheels are floating on top of them rather than rolling. This flex also makes it difficult to jump over curbs and the Pockit received the lowest score in our wheel vibration test.

This compact stroller features only one brake pedal on the right rear wheel, which is extremely small and often difficult to reach with your feet. The brake pedal is easy to operate with just one hand. However, you might be required to lean forward in order to apply more force when braking over rough terrain. The front wheels come with built-in suspension that makes this stroller more adept at handling bumpy urban streets and sidewalks than its smaller counterparts, but it is still not as responsive as some other models.

The Pockit is one of the tiniest strollers on the market and comes with an impressive array of features in such small of a package. It comes with a stunning sun canopy, is easy to use, and even includes an umbrella bag and a rain cover as part of the package. It is the ideal stroller for parents who need an easy and quick solution for everyday family life or when traveling.

Baby Trend Expedition Stroller

The Baby Trend Expedition is a budget-friendly model that is well-performing. Its large bicycle tires and lockable front swivel wheel allow you to maintain the pace when running or slow it down to stroll. It's also easy to convert it into a travel system by adding one of Baby Trend's EZ Flex-Loc or Inertia infant car seats to the child's tray included that can be swung away from the frame for quick access. The jogger is designed with thoughtful storage solutions, including an extra-large basket and a parent tray that includes two cup holders as well as covered storage. It also has a ratcheting canopy with multiple positions, as well as a ratcheting canopy to block the sun and wind.

The Expedition is built with a sturdy steel frame, but the hinge point and the plastic connections feel cheap and lack tightness when folding. It also requires two hands to fold and has dual finger releases on each side of the frame, near the handlebar. This can be a bit awkward for a single adult. The basket is of a good size, but it comes with an upper limit of 5 pounds, which limits what you can put in it.

The larger wheels of this jogger enable it to roll smoothly over rough terrain. Its front swivel can be locked to jog, or unlocked to turn. It comes with a trigger-fold, making it easy to store and transport in your car or home. It's a great option for parents who want to keep healthy while raising their children.
